The Orvane Labs bike cage and the east and west parking gates operate on separate access schedules, and facilities desk staff should note that visitor vehicles may only use the west gate between 07:00 and 19:00. Cyclists requesting cage access must show a valid day pass, and their details should be entered in the access ledger before the cage is opened. Gates must never be propped open, even briefly, during deliveries. When a manual override is required at either gate, use the code below.

staff pass of fadup-fawig = bdg-FUNKS-4

Step 4: Localize date formats. After upgrading Brimvale to 5.2, all date rendering moves to the locale table in the core schema. Run the patcher, then verify that tickets from Ostermark tenants show DD.MM.YYYY and Lunfield tenants show MM/DD/YYYY. If a tenant reports raw epoch values, their locale row is missing — insert it manually before escalating. Do not edit format strings in the UI config; they are ignored now. To run the patcher against staging, connect using the string below.

replica DSN, yahaf-yagaf: mongodb://tamath_svc:a2netSk3RZMuTj@db-d084.novacsoft.internal:5432/ralmir

# Spoolaris Environment Variables

Spoolaris is the print-spooler microservice behind the Quartzline suite. Plugins run in-process and inherit the service environment. Required: `SPOOLARIS_PORT`, `SPOOLARIS_QUEUE_DIR`, `SPOOLARIS_LOG_LEVEL`. Optional: `SPOOLARIS_MAX_JOBS` (default 50), `SPOOLARIS_RETRY_MS` (default 2000). Plugins must not write to the queue directory directly; use the job API. All authenticated calls from your plugin to the spooler core are signed with a shared secret, set on the next line of the service's env file:

sealed setting: RELAY_SECRET5=82864